SIDE STORY 1: Yan-ge Is Sick.

When the first snowflakes fell one after the other, the sudden cold dew startled the wild geese.

This year, the cold winter seemed to have arrived earlier than ever.

When the sun was about to rise in the East, Yan HeQing got up to go to the morning Court. Xiao YuAn, on the other hand, was still wrapped in the blankets, sound asleep.

Snowflakes fluttered onto the window, while the earth was covered with eye-catching white snow.

It was a sudden winter chill, and the quilt on the bed wasn’t thick. When Yan HeQing left the bed, Xiao YuAn, who had no one to cuddle with, felt a chill on his body as he uneasily pulled the quilt and curled up.

Yan HeQing quickly ordered someone to bring a charcoal stove.

But because the cold came out of nowhere, the Palace wasn’t prepared for such an event, and it took some time for the charcoal to heat up while in the fire. Even when Yan HeQing was already dressed in his Court attire, the stove hadn’t been delivered yet.

Then, a servant brought over a thick cloak made with gold silk, decorated with a dragon pattern for Yan HeQing to wear. “Your Majesty, it suddenly snowed last night. Today is a very cold day, so His Majesty should quickly put this on.”

Yan HeQing ‘hm-mmed’, took the cloak, and turned around to look at the inner bedroom. Since Xiao YuAn was restless in his sleep as he rolled around the bed, Yan HeQing wrapped him with the thick cloak.

Seeing this, the servant hurried to say: “This servant will go and get another cloak.”

However, when Yan HeQing saw the time, he was worried about arriving late for the morning Court. He simply said that there was no need to bring anything, got up, and left the Imperial Bedchamber.

The green bamboo branches were covered with snow, as white as white jade, and as his feet squeaked in the snow, Yan HeQing was only wearing his Royal clothes. As the cold wind blew by, Yan HeQing felt chilled to the bones, but since he’s a person who doesn’t want to show his emotions in the open, the servants around him couldn’t see that he felt cold.

After going to Court, Yan HeQing devoted himself to the government affairs without any distractions. So much that he even forgot whether he was cold or not. Only after Court, did he notice that his hands and feet were icy cold. Fortunately, the servant brought a new cloak for him. After putting on the cloak, Yan HeQing felt a bit more warm.

When Yan HeQing returned to his bedchamber, he found that Xiao YuAn was already up.

Since Xiao YuAn hadn’t stepped outside the bedchamber, his beautiful hair was scattered and it wasn’t tied up. Xiao YuAn was afraid of the cold, so he wrapped himself in a thick fur coat, sitting on a couch decorated with vermilion and gold carvings1 in the outer room. He was holding his head with one hand, as he read some letters.

Tian Xiang was stirring the charcoal in the stove to burn more vigorously. In her left hand, she was holding an octagonal furnace, decorated with magpies surrounding plums2.

The octagonal furnace was exquisitely crafted, and couldn’t be used by the maids of the Palace. However, this particular one was given to Tian Xiang by Xiao YuAn.

Tian Xiang poked the charcoal twice, making the charcoal ash roll up in the air from the stove, which made her cough. When Xiao YuAn saw this, he brought her some tea and asked her to rest. Then, he took the fire poker and began to stir the charcoal stove by himself.

After a while, the charcoal in the stove burned brightly, and Xiao YuAn clapped his hands triumphantly, with a face that said ‘I’m worthy of praise’. When Xiao YuAn turned around, he saw Yan HeQing, who had just returned from the Court.

At that moment, Xiao YuAn’s eyes instantly lit up as he shouted: “Yan-ge! You’re back!”

Yan HeQing nodded and walked towards him.

Xiao YuAn stepped forward to pull him close to the stove: “It’s so cold today, I wonder why the temperature had dropped all of a sudden. Quick, come here and warm up.”

Tian Xiang covered her lips and smiled. After bowing to Yan HeQing and Xiao YuAn, she leaned over, preparing to leave. When she tried to give the octagonal furnace back to Xiao YuAn, this one was pushed back by Xiao YuAn himself: “You can take it and use it.”

Tian Xiang quickly thanked and bowed her head to Xiao YuAn, then she withdrew from the bedchamber.

Only Yan HeQing and Xiao YuAn were left behind in the bedchamber.

When Yan HeQing set his eyes on the letter in Xiao YuAn’s hand, Xiao YuAn noticed. As he waved the letter on his hand, he said with a smile: “This morning, Tian Xiang brought this letter to me. It was written by Baizhu, saying that my godson’s first birthday test3 was already held. He said that the child caught medicinal herbs, so it could be said that he will become a physician in the future. Baizhu also mentioned that Shifu, LiuAn, Fengyue and Auntie are all well.”

Yan HeQing listened to Xiao YuAn’s ramblings as he hummed softly.

No one in Taoyuan Village knew that something had happened to Xiao YuAn, and even after his rebirth, Xiao YuAn would often exchange letters with them.

However, when they heard that the Southern Yan Kingdom would take over the Western Shu Kingdom through marriage, Yang LiuAn and Xiao Fengyue thought that Yan HeQing had lost interest in Xiao YuAn. Three letters were sent through fast horses, every word in the letters were filled with worry and anxiety. They even wanted to come to the Capital to look for Xiao YuAn.

Xiao YuAn wrote back a long letter to appease them, telling them that the alliance through marriage was false, and that he had changed his own appearance. Only then did Yang LiuAn and Xiao Fengyue give up on the idea of rescuing him.

Xiao YuAn carefully and lovingly put the letter into the wooden box. Then he sighed with emotion and said to Yan HeQing: “This letter was sent all the way from their hometown. I even think that it was written in early autumn, but it’s snowing now.”

Yan HeQing could see Xiao YuAn’s frustration, so he tried to comfort him: “If you want, you can go see them.”

Xiao YuAn rubbed his chin and said: “Well, yeah. But they will be very surprised when they see my current appearance. Besides, I don’t know whether my Shifu will be deceived by the excuse of ‘disguise’.”

Yan HeQing said softly: “You are you, and they know you well. There’s no such thing as deceiving them.”

Xiao YuAn smiled: “Well, that too! Ah, Yan-ge, how could your body still be so cold when you’ve stayed close to the stove for so long? Come here, give me your hands, I’ll warm them up for you!” Then Xiao YuAn grabbed Yan HeQing’s hand, pulling them to his face: “When I woke up this morning, I found a cloak on the bed. Did you go out only wearing your Royal robes? Don’t you feel cold?”

""

In fact, Yan HeQing had actually felt some kind of cold feeling in his chest for a long time now. But in the end, he said: “I don’t feel cold.”

Xiao YuAn said: “I don’t want you to ‘feel’ whether you’re cold or not, I’ll do it for you. Listen to me, just listen to me. If I say that you’re cold, then you’re cold. Your mouth is feeling especially cold right now, isn’t it? Now that your hands are warm, it’s time to warm your lips.”

Yan HeQing: “…..”

Yan HeQing couldn’t even have the chance to reply, when he was suddenly kissed by Xiao YuAn, who had a smile on his face.

But soon, Yan HeQing responded to the kiss by pressing the back of Xiao YuAn’s neck, turning from being on the receiving end to the one taking the initiative.

Yan HeQing’s lips and tongue were slightly cool, which made Xiao YuAn feel as if he was kissing snow, but the careful licking of their tongues shared a trace of sweetness.

Xiao YuAn thought: ‘Why is it so cold? Ah, forget it, Yan-ge’s physical quality won’t allow him to fall sick!’

However, the next day, Yan HeQing woke up with a cold.
